After Ship, a Great Place to Work Certified company, is transforming the global eCommerce landscape. Founded in 2012, After Ship is a post‑purchase SaaS company on a mission to build the world’s leading automation platform for ecommerce merchants.

After Ship unifies shipping & labels, order tracking, AI predictive delivery, and returns management into one system—giving merchants a single place to manage and automate everything that happens after checkout. By centralizing these workflows, After Ship enables merchants to reduce customer support inquiries, deliver a more reliable and engaging customer experiences, and unlock incremental revenue at every post‑purchase touchpoint.

After Ship integrates seamlessly with ecommerce platforms including Shopify and Tik Tok Shop, and connects with more than 1,200 carriers worldwide. Today, over 20,000 businesses—including Samsung, Gymshark, Vivino, Harry’s, Mous, and Rakuten—rely on After Ship to turn every post‑purchase moment into an opportunity to build trust, reduce costs, and drive repeat purchases.

Built for a global market from day one, After Ship operates with an engineering‑driven, internationally distributed team. The company employs more than 450 people across 8 offices, spanning North America, Europe, and Asia, and representing over 20 cities worldwide.

What You’ll Do

At After Ship, our IT runs on a Hub‑Spoke model: our APAC IT Hub owns global identity (Google workspace), SaaS automation, Security frameworks, and MDM policies, while our regional specialists own local execution and employee experience. As the Senior IT Specialist for NA/EU, you’ll be the face of IT for 100+ employees across the region, operating from our Toronto hub.

  • Regional IT Support – Serve as the primary technical point of contact for NA/EU employees, resolving hardware, software, and network issues during local business hours—from Mac Book boot failures and VPN issues to Google Workspace access, peripheral setup, and SaaS permission requests. Operate to clear service commitments: 15–30 min response for executive‑impacting issues, same‑day resolution for workflow‑blocking issues, and same‑day laptop swap for Toronto‑based employees.
  • Lifecycle Management – Own the full Day‑1‑to‑offboarding employee experience—laptop procurement and zero‑touch configuration, Day‑1 IT orientation covering policies and security, account provisioning across our core stack, secure device retrieval and wiping on exit, and timely deprovisioning of access.
